For example, in cases involving domestic violence or child protection, special measures can be put in place to protect victims and ensure their safety. The government and the judiciary have invested in digital transformation to improve access to justice.
These measures can include the use of video links for victims to testify from a safe location or the provision of additional time for testimony.
In some cases, vulnerable witnesses may also have access to a support person who can help them through the process.
